
Lake Valley, Spinach, Bloomsdale Longstanding
- Seed Depth: 1/2³ (13mm)
- Plant Space: 6³ (15cm)
- Row Space: 12³ (30cm)
- Sprouts In: 5-10 days
- Spinach is super cold-hardy and can be planted in very early spring and fall, or winter in mild areas. Choose a location with full sun to light shade and rich, non-acidic soil. Keep evenly moist until they germinate. Sow every ten days for continuous harvest.
- Harvest by pulling entire plant when leaves are still young and tasty. In many cold winter areas, fall planted spinach will over-winter and produce very early spring crops.
Lake Valley- Spinach, Bloomsdale Longstanding
Bloomsdale is an old-time favorite in the garden. It is quick to produce bunches of crinkle-leaved rosettes that are packed with vitamins and minerals. Best flavor and production are achieved when grown during cool weather
